DUK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

2,265 of the 7,459 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Duke Energy (DUK)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$64.2B — up 17% from $55B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 227 funds opened new DUK positions and 121 closed out — a net gain of 106 holders — while 929 added to existing stakes and 779 trimmed.

The largest buyer was GQG Partners, adding an estimated $1.16B.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$214M.
